Using multiple parallel sequencing on Illumina platform, we identified eight microRNAs that showed significant opposite changes of gene expression in cells of the hormone-sensitive LNCaP prostate cancer cell line and in cells of the hormone-resistant DU-145 cell line, in comparison to the microRNA expression in the normal prostate tissue cells. We found that the insulin-like growth factor 1 receptor (IGF1R) gene is a target of five microRNAs whose expression is increased in LNCaP cells and reduced in DU-145 cells.
